When to have a boil lanced? If your boil doesn’t improve within two weeks or shows sign of serious infection, consult your doctor. They may recommend lancing and draining the boil and may prescribe antibiotics.
When should you have an abscess lanced? Call your doctor if any of the following occur with an abscess: You have a sore larger than 1 cm or a half-inch across. The sore continues to enlarge or becomes more painful. The sore is on or near your rectal or groin area.
Can Urgent Care lance a boil? Boils are usually not a serious condition and will usually resolve on their own. However, there are certain situations when you should seek medical care after a boil develops. Medfast Urgent Care Centers offer fast, professional medical treatment for boils.
Do doctors always lance boils? Others become large enough that any antibiotics taken by mouth or topically will not penetrate deep enough into the boil or abscess to take care of the infection. In these cases, the boil will need to be drained (or lanced). There is no specific size of a boil that must be drained.

Is boiling water good for killing weeds?
The boiling water treatment is inexpensive and effective in burning weeds. Hot water works better on broad-leaf weeds than it does on established perennials, woody plants and grass, according to University of California Integrated Pest Management Online.

What does boil some water mean?
If your local health officials issue a boil water advisory, you should use bottled water or boil tap water. This is because a boil water advisory means your community’s water has, or could have, germs that can make you sick. … Use bottled or boiled water for drinking, and to prepare and cook food.
